写了一个React开源播放器组件,了解一下?
1、qierplayer是一个基于React编写的在线视频播放器组件,具有以下特点和功能:主要功能:基础播放控制:包括暂停、播放功能。全屏显示:支持一键全屏播放。音量调节:用户可调节音量大小。进度条拖拽:支持进度条拖拽以快速跳转播放位置。倍速播放:提供不同倍速播放选项。
2、介绍:qier-player 是一个基于 React 编写的在线视频播放器组件,界面简洁,操作流畅,具有大部分视频播放器的基础功能。支持视频清晰度的切换,提供了原画、4K、2K、1080P、720P、480P 的视频源接口。
3、React Native App开发视频播放功能采用的组件 在React Native App开发中实现视频播放功能,需考虑全屏模式、APP最小化时恢复播放等功能。React-Native-Video组件在React Native中用于实现视频播放,其自带的API满足基本需求。
4、Ant Motion是由Ant Design团队推出的一款专为React应用打造的动画规范与组件库,旨在简化动画开发流程,提升用户界面的活力与舒适度。其主要功能包括: 提供一套动效语言,增强用户体验,描述界面元素间的层级关系与用户操作反馈。
5、React是一个开源的JavaScript库,专门用于构建动态、交互式的用户界面。它因其高效的性能和对现代浏览器的高适应性,而被广泛用于构建Web应用程序和移动应用的用户界面。组件化开发:React的核心思想之一是组件化开发,即将用户界面分解为一系列小部件或组件。
reactchrome加载cdn失败导致页面跳转
1、CDN链接错误导致的。需要检查在页面中引用的CDN链接是否正确,包括版本号、文件路径等,确保链接没有拼写错误或缺失,若是有错误或是缺失的情况就会导致错误。
2、利用浏览器缓存:设置HTTP缓存头:在服务器端通过设置HTTP缓存头(如Cache-Control、Expires等),控制浏览器缓存资源的有效时间。利用浏览器本地存储:如localStorage、sessionStorage等存储关键数据,减少页面跳转时的数据请求。
3、恶意代码加载伪造的jQuery文件,通过pastebin.com/fuCxWTGA或指定Referer和User-Agent请求获取。恶意jQuery源码在页面底部增加浮动广告,并引入站点访问统计脚本。
create-react-app不得不说的事儿以及如何升级react18
对于这个问题,虽然业界巨头facebook给出了答案:create-react-app(简称CRA),但是cra的开发环境非常简陋,虽然提供了诸多配置,但是还不够易用,如果用CRA来简单做一个demo,他非常胜任。
React 并发的一个重要特性是渲染可中断。React 可以在渲染过程中暂停,稍后继续,甚至放弃正在进行的更新。确保即使在中断后,UI 也能保持一致,通过等待 DOM 变换直到完整比较完成实现。后台准备新屏幕渲染,不会阻塞主线程,使得 UI 在任何时候都能立即响应用户输入。
React 并发的核心理念是隐藏并发细节,让开发者专注于应用程序的逻辑。它支持渲染可中断性,即使在更新过程中暂停,也能保持UI的一致性。这种特性使得UI在处理用户输入时保持流畅,不会阻塞主线程。新版本中,React 18引入了悬念(Suspense)、过渡和流媒体服务渲染等工具,旨在充分利用并发渲染的效率。
不再支持 typescript flag 和 NODE_PATH:要将TypeScript添加到Create React App 0.0中,应使用 --template typescript 标志。已经删除了对 NODE_PATH 的支持,建议通过在 jsconfig.json 中设置基本路径来替代。Jest升级到26:提升了测试框架的版本,以支持新的功能和改进。
React设计原理详解:深入理解React 18源码(一)React的核心工具之一是jsx,它是一种语法扩展,开发者编写的代码会被Babel编译成ReactElement,进一步转化为FiberNode,这是一种虚拟DOM在React中的实现,它能表达组件状态和节点关系,同时具备可扩展性。
react项目怎么启动(react怎么用)
React在使用create-react-app创建项目慢的解决办法你换一个英文目录试试吧。例如在D盘根目录建立一个React的目录,然后在React这个目录执行create-react-app来创建一个项目。有可能是目录原因的。
安装Node.js和npm 确保您的系统上已安装Node.js和npm。如未安装,请从Node.js官网下载并安装最新版本。创建React应用 使用Create React App工具: 在命令行中输入npx createreactapp myreactapp。 这将自动生成一个包含初始配置的React项目。
在IDEA中打开后端SpringBoot项目。新建或编辑运行/调试配置,配置项目的启动参数,如端口号、上下文路径等。启动后端应用,确保后端服务正常运行。数据库配置:若项目需要连接数据库,将MySQL或其他数据库的连接信息输入到项目的配置文件中。
React和SpringBoot的前后端分离项目启动流程如下:首先,确保你的开发环境配置正确。在Windows上,从Git官网下载并安装Git,小米代码仓库可通过git.n.xiaomi.com获取。安装完成后,检查Java版本(推荐使用JDK 8),并安装Maven(版本建议x),务必注意settings.xml的配置,避免常见问题。